Housings and Turnkey Systems
The following pages show examples of individual packaging solutions as well as two different standard housings
that can be used as evaluation platforms together with our 3U CompactPCI
®
product range from a PowerPC
®
5200 based F12N consuming 1 Watt up to the latest Intel
®
Core
TM
2 Duo SBC consuming 47 Watts. With a 4-slot
backplane in the standard compact desktop or wall-mount system (0701-0046) up to an 8-slot backplane in the
standard rack-mount system (0701-0021) the range of available single-board computers can also be combined
with any kind of additional I/O functionality.
Whenever required we define and propose individual packaging tailored to the needs of the application in terms of
performance, functionality and environmental conditions. Only a perfect knowledge of the final application allows
to configure the optimum system from the board-level content to power management, including appropriate
testing according to CE and environmental qualification.
A small footprint system, for example, can just be built around a 2-slot backplane and a pluggable PSU. Programs
and application may be stored directly on the CPU board in CompactFlash or on a hard disk instead of using extra
space inside the housing. Even if Intel
®
-based such a system can be installed without forced air cooling, destined
to work in a -40 to +85°C temperature environment. Passive heat sinks take the power dissipation of the critical
parts out of the system.
Larger systems can for example be equipped with backplanes of up to eight slots or more, also supporting rear I/O
via the backplane. Appropriate ventilation, power supplies and additional room for mass storages is considered
depending on the application.
Depending on the board combination in the system power supplies can reach from a low-cost firmly installed
ATX up to pluggable models, delivering between 35 Watts up to 350 Watts and more. Depending on the type of
application the technical requirements for the PSU may be different in terms of voltage input ranges, AC or DC
supply, safety aspects (monitoring, self diagnosis) and environment (operation temperature, shock, vibration,
humidity). For handling and maintenance purposes it may be necessary to use pluggable PSUs.
More complex systems are built for example to support multiprocessing or hardware clusters based on a variety
of tailored backplanes. For safety-critical and mission-critical applications we configure any kind of redundancy
structure like 2oo3 or 2oo4 systems.
